Leadership Briefing — Gross Margin Review

Welcome aboard. Quick primer before your first review: blended gross margin slipped from 44% to 39% over two quarters. Main culprits are freight on the Skylark line and heavy discounting in the Westbrook territory. The Pellamy range is actually holding up fine. Finance has a remediation plan with three levers — pricing, routing, and mix. The details worth keeping close are in the confidential note below.

internal memo for kagup-faduf: Project Casax slips by one quarter because of the audit delay.

## Authentication

The Pointsmith loyalty-points ledger won't talk to you without a key, full stop. Every request — earning, redeeming, or just reading a balance — goes through the internal auth gateway, and anonymous calls get a flat 401 with no hints. For local dev, point your client at the sandbox ledger, which mirrors prod behavior but resets nightly so you can't break anything real. Rate limits are generous (600 req/min) but shared per key, so don't hammer it in loops. The sandbox authenticates with the following key:

service key, fawip-bajef: kto11_Qt5wZK9vdNC

**Vendor note: Inkmill markdown pipeline**

Rendering for Parchway docs is outsourced to Inkmill under an annual contract, renewing each March. They handle sanitization and PDF export; we own the upload queue. SLA: 4-hour response on rendering failures. Escalate only after two failed retries. Their support desk is reachable at the address below.

billing contact of hahaf-baguf = zorael.tammir.jorius@sivrelhq.internal

The renewal of our three-year agreement with Torvane Materials has been assessed in detail. Proposed terms include a 4.2% unit-price increase, partially offset by improved volume rebates and extended payment terms of sixty days. Sensitivity analysis indicates a net annual cost impact of under 1% on the Meridia product line, assuming stable demand. Legal has flagged no material changes to liability clauses. We recommend approval, subject to the conditions outlined in the confidential note below.

confidential, yawip-bahif: Zorokox Partners plans to lower the Casax list price by 28.0 percent in April. The board signed off on a budget of $271.0 million for Project Juldor. The renewal with Pelokox Partners closes at $410.1 million a year, 3.4 percent below the last contract. Project Pelok slips by a full year because of the audit delay.